The${Newline}${Space}'server' monitors the UPS and notifies the 'clients' when the UPS is on${Newline}${Space}battery or has a low battery. --- nut-2.4.3.orig/debian/nut-xml.manpages +++ nut-2.4.3/debian/nut-xml.manpages @@ -0,0 +1 @@ +debian/tmp/usr/share/man/man8/netxml-ups.8 --- nut-2.4.3.orig/debian/Makefile.am +++ nut-2.4.3/debian/Makefile.am @@ -0,0 +1,8 @@ +EXTRA_DIST = changelog control copyright description.subst hotplug \ + nut-cgi.config nut-cgi.docs nut-cgi.examples nut-cgi.postinst nut-cgi.postrm \ + nut-cgi.preinst nut-cgi.README.Debian nut-cgi.templates nut.config \ + nut.default nut.dirs nut.docs nut.examples nut-hal-drivers.docs \ + nut.init nut.links nut.postinst nut.postrm nut.preinst nut.prerm \ + nut.README.Debian nut.templates nut.TODO.Debian \ + rules watch po/ca.po po/cs.po po/de.po po/fr.po po/POTFILES.in \ + po/pt.po po/pt_BR.po po/templates.pot po/vi.po --- nut-2.4.3.orig/debian/nut.README.Debian +++ nut-2.4.3/debian/nut.README.Debian @@ -0,0 +1,155 @@ +Network UPS Tools - Quick Start for Debian +------------------------------------------ + +Anyway, here are the quick start instructions for using nut: + +These Quick Start instructions are useful for a UPS connected to a single +machine. For a UPS connected to multiple machines, additional steps must be +taken, as outlined at the end of this file, including the notice regarding +SECURITY CONSIDERATIONS. + +(I) Upgrading +============= + +In case of upgrading, follow instructions given in: +/usr/share/doc/nut/UPGRADING + +Note that service(s) (driver(s), upsd, upsmon) are not restarted upon +upgrade, to avoid service disruption. You have to manually do it. + +(II) Installation +================= + +Configuration files are located in /etc/nut/ +In order to tune NUT configuration according to your needs, follow the below +information, along with the one provided inside these files. + +(1) /etc/nut/nut.conf (see 'man 5 nut.conf' for more information) + Edit /etc/nut/nut.conf and modify the "MODE" variable according to your + configuration. + + You can also fine tune the daemons options through UPSD_OPTIONS and + UPSMON_OPTIONS. + +The steps 2 to 5 are only required if you use a "standalone" or "netserver" +MODE. If you are running in "netclient" MODE, jump directly to section 6. + +(2) /etc/nut/ups.conf (see 'man 5 ups.conf' for more information) + + Edit /etc/nut/ups.conf and add something like: + [myups] + driver = usbhid-ups + port = auto + Use the appropriate driver for your UPS and select the correct port. + To select the driver, take a look at the UPS compatibility list: + /usr/share/nut/driver.list + + If you have more than one UPS, add as many entries as needed. + + If you wish to test manually whether your configuration of ups.conf is + correct, you may invoke upsdrvctl by hand (as root): + /sbin/upsdrvctl start [myups] + /sbin/upsdrvctl stop [myups] + + Ensure that the permissions of ups.conf do not permit the world to + read it. It should already be thus, but the following command + accomplishes this: + chown root:nut /etc/nut/ups.conf + chmod 640 /etc/nut/ups.conf + +(3) device port permissions + The nut user need to be able to access the device port both for reading and + writing. + + For serial devices, there are two possibilities: + + a) You can add the nut user to the dialout group. + The following command accomplishes this: + addgroup nut dialout + + This is not done by default for security reason on Debian, but is applied + on Ubuntu. + + b) Another solution, for system supporting udev, is to create a file + (for example /etc/udev/rules.d/52_nut-serialups.rules), placed + after 020_permissions.rules and to add something like: + KERNEL=="ttyS1", GROUP="nut" + + where 'ttyS1' has to be replaced by the exact name of your serial port. + + For USB devices, permissions are automatically set by the + 52-nut-usbups.rules udev rules file. + +(4) /etc/nut/upsd.conf (see 'man 5 upsd.conf' for more information) + the default /etc/nut/upsd.conf is fine for a "standalone" configuration. + If you are in "netserver" MODE, you will have to modify the LISTEN option + to something suitable. + + Ensure that the permissions of upsd.conf do not permit the world to + read it. It should already be thus, but the following command + accomplishes this: + chown root:nut /etc/nut/upsd.conf + chmod 640 /etc/nut/upsd.conf + +(5) /etc/nut/upsd.users (see 'man 5 upsd.users' for more information) + Edit /etc/nut/upsd.users and add something like the following, + without the comments, in order to define a user: + [monmaster] + password = blah + upsmon master + Please use *different* usernames and passwords than you use on your + system; see the note regarding SECURITY CONSIDERATIONS at the end + of this file. + + Ensure that the permissions of upsd.users do not permit the world to + read it. It should already be thus, but the following command + accomplishes this: + chown root:nut /etc/nut/upsd.users + chmod 640 /etc/nut/upsd.users + +(6) /etc/nut/upsmon.conf (see 'man 5 upsmon.conf' for more information) + Edit /etc/nut/upsmon.conf and add something like the following: + MONITOR myups@localhost 1 monmaster blah master + POWERDOWNFLAG /etc/killpower + SHUTDOWNCMD "/sbin/shutdown -h +0" + + Ensure that the permissions of upsmon.conf do not permit the world to + read it. It should already be thus, but the following commands + accomplishes this: + chown root:nut /etc/nut/upsmon.conf + chmod 640 /etc/nut/upsmon.conf + +(7) /etc/default/nut + This file is not used anymore. + nut.conf provides all the needed features to replace this file. + +(8) start the daemon + Invoke '/etc/init.d/nut start' to start the daemon(s). Check + /var/log/syslog to ensure that upsd, appropriate drivers, and upsmon + started up correctly. + + +Additional Notes for Sharing a UPS +---------------------------------- +If you have multiple machines connected to the same UPS, you will need to +(a) modify the access control lists in upsd.conf on the server; +(b) add additional users to upsd.users on the server; and +(c) configure upsmon.conf on the clients. + +Please note that upsmon on a client machine and upsd on a server machine need +to communicate via your network. This means that you need to ensure that all +the networking equipment (hub, switch, router, etc.) between the client and the +server is powered by the UPS. Otherwise, when the power goes down, the network +connection between the client machine will be broken and the client will not +be told to shut down. + +SECURITY CONSIDERATIONS +----------------------- +Finally, please be aware of the following SECURITY CONSIDERATIONS: the TCP +communications between the client daemon, upsmon, and the server daemon, upsd, +send the username and passwords defined in upsd.users and used in upsmon.conf +over the wire UNENCRYPTED. This means that somebody could sniff the username +and password. A version that encrypts the connection using SSL should be +available someday. + +Please see the documentation in /usr/share/doc/nut/docs for more information. ---
